Bring on Arsenal! Aquilani desperate to start for Liverpool in crunch clash

10 December 2009 12:11
Alberto Aquilani is relishing a crack at Arsenal after making his first start for Liverpool.[LNB]The £20million summer signing from Roma had to be patient as he recovered from ankle surgery and made just three substitute appearances before Wednesday night's Champions League dead rubber against Fiorentina.[LNB]But the Italian midfielder played most of the 2-1 defeat against his countrymen and is desperate to be involved when the Gunners arrive at Arsenal on Sunday.[LNB] Raring to go: Aquilani wants to play a key role against Arsenal at Anfield[LNB]'I started for the first time in seven or eight months - that's very hard,' he told the Reds' official website.[LNB]'After that length of time it's difficult to be fit but I'm happy because I'm playing and that means I'm getting there. My ankle is better, it's improved, so while the result was not good here, from a personal point of view it's been good physically.[LNB]  'I can play better but it was important to start and to run. I need to play, play, play because I'm in a new team. The first half I was okay and then after that a little bit tired, but that's normal.
